Monitor Datazoom telemetry with Datadog

Modern video streaming workflows are composed of many different services, including encoders, origins, ad servers, content delivery networks (CDNs), and more. This wide range of options enables organizations to choose the tools that best fit their needs, but it also introduces considerable observability challenges. For instance, you may have limited access to the log data from each layer of your video workflow, and the data you can access likely isn’t standardized.

Cribl and GitOps: Go From Development to Production

Git integration has always been at the foundation of Stream. In the fall 2021 release of Cribl Stream (both on-prem software and Cloud), our Enterprise users have a received set of APIs to separate the development and deployment of Stream. Stream GitOps connects with your favorite git based versioning platforms and leverages their PR, approve/reject, and CI/CD workflows to push production-ready changes from a development branch into a main branch or release.

What's next in Kubernetes monitoring, Prometheus histograms, observability, and more: KubeCon EU 2022 in review

In May, a team from Grafana Labs descended on Valencia, Spain, to share their latest insights on the cloud native landscape at KubeCon + CloudNativeCon EU 2022. Along with diving into the future of Kubernetes monitoring with kubectl alpha events and multi-cloud deployments, Grafanistas presented an overview of the Prometheus ecosystem with an eye towards how sparse high-resolution histograms are going to change the game.

Solving slow web applications with the Kentik Page Load test

Kentik Synthetics is all about proactive monitoring. With synthetic monitoring, you can investigate users’ digital experience by peeling back, layer by layer, exactly what’s going on in every aspect of the digital experience from the network layer all the way to application. Because synthetic tests can be so granular, the results provide different information than you can get from flows, streaming telemetry or other observability data.

In 2022, should we still be wrestling with slow computers?

The invention of computers gave us the promise of high speed, a new user experience, and extreme reliability. Early research by Robert B. Miller, who helped design some of the earliest IBM computers, discussed the transactions between humans and computers. Miller believed users require a response from a machine within two seconds to maintain their concentration and productivity.
